The Cosmic Caravan: A Super Furry Animals Retrospective

Formed in the rugged heart of North Wales in 1993, Super Furry Animals (SFA) emerged as a vibrant, kaleidoscopic force in the UK music scene. Initially a mischievous, genre-bending collective, they quickly established a reputation for their audacious songwriting, experimental instrumentation, and a fearless embrace of the surreal. Their early work, particularly albums like Fuzzy Logic Perceptionds (1996) and Radiator (1997), showcased a band unafraid to blend blistering guitar anthems with synthesiser wizardry, krautrock rhythms, and undeniably catchy melodies.

Throughout the late 90s and early 2000s, SFA solidified their status as one of Britain's most inventive and beloved bands. Albums like Guerrilla (1999), with its eclectic sonic palette and socially conscious lyrics, and the critically acclaimed Rings Around the World (2001), a masterpiece of psychedelic pop and ambitious production, cemented their place in the pantheon of great British songwriters. Phantom Power (2003) continued this trajectory of critical and commercial success, offering a more mature yet still wonderfully eccentric collection of tunes.

Their discography is a testament to their enduring creativity. From the more stripped-back, guitar-driven Hey Venus (2007) to the ambitious, politically charged Dark Days/Light Years (2009), they’ve consistently explored new sonic territories without ever losing the core DNA that makes them so special. And let’s not forget the solo projects, particularly Gruff Rhys's equally imaginative and critically lauded solo albums, which have further showcased the depth and breadth of his creative genius.

The Utilita Arena Cardiff: A Temple of Sound and Spectacle

For a band with such a rich and expansive sonic tapestry, the Utilita Arena Cardiff is the perfect canvas. This state-of-the-art venue, situated right in the heart of the Welsh capital, is no stranger to hosting world-class acts. Originally known as the Cardiff International Arena (CIA), it underwent a significant rebranding and refurbishment in recent years, emerging as the Utilita Arena Cardiff, a modern and impressive facility capable of accommodating thousands of passionate fans.

With a capacity that can flex to accommodate around 7,500 attendees for seated concerts and up to 7,000 for standing events, the Utilita Arena Cardiff offers an intimate yet grand atmosphere. Its design prioritises excellent sightlines from virtually every vantage point, ensuring that whether you're up close to the stage or enjoying a panoramic view from the upper tiers, you'll have a fantastic perspective of the performance. The acoustics are also a key feature, engineered to deliver a powerful and clear sound experience, crucial for a band like SFA whose intricate arrangements and sonic layers deserve to be heard in all their glory.
